What Is Transportation Maintenance Software?

Transportation maintenance software is a CMMS-style system that manages vehicle and equipment maintenance through work orders, inspections, and preventive maintenance scheduling tied to asset records. It reduces repeat failures by centralizing maintenance history, work status, and supporting documentation so teams can track issues across depots, routes, and fleet units. It also helps maintenance leaders manage compliance-ready records and downtime or workload reporting by asset, location, or maintenance type.
